Cystic Fibrosis is an autosomal recessive disease that affects chromosome 7 on the DNA helix. The parents of the child with cystic fibrosis are both carriers of the disorder and likely have no symptoms and have no idea they are carriers. The disease is caused by a mutation in cystic fibrosis transmembrane regulator (CFTR). The CFTR regulates the flow of salt and fluids in and out of the cell. The CFTR protein provides instructions for the channel than transports negatively charged particles called chloride ions in and out of the cell and across the tissues. The lack of this channel causes the build-up of thick and sticky mucus because chloride helps with the movement of water across the tissues that assist with thinning the mucus. (CF Genetics: The Basics, 2020) The organs that are affected most frequently are the lungs, digestive organs, pancreas, and reproductive organs. The thick mucus causes frequent lung infections and the cyst in the lungs. The thick mucus blocks the ducts of the pancreas and prevents the transport of digestive enzymes leading to malnutrition. The production of insulin is also affected by the thick mucus and cystic fibrosis patients can develop diabetes-related to this. Males with cystic fibrosis are infertile due to mucus plugging the vas deferens. Female with cystic fibrosis frequently have difficulty during pregnancy (Cystic Fibrosis, 2020). Cystic fibrosis is a recessive disease and both parents must be carries to produce a child who has cystic fibrosis. The chances of two carriers having a child with cystic fibrosis are 25% and the chances that the child will have a 50% chance they are a carrier of the mutation and a 25% chance that the child will not be a carrier or have the disease. The person with cystic fibrosis has a child with a cystic fibrosis carrier then they have a 50% chance the child will have cystic fibrosis and a 50% chance they will be a carrier (Cystic Fibrosis, n.d.). Cystic fibrosis is common in the Caucasian population with a frequency rate of 1 in 2500-3500 births. African American have a frequency rate of 1-17000 and Asian population have a frequency rate of 1-3100 births (CF Genetics: The Basics, 2020)

reply 1 There various components to the Medicare and Medicaid programs. Three of the major of the Medicare program include Part A, Part B, and Part D. Part A is known as the hospital insurance as it covers inpatient hospital services, hospice care, and home health care among other services (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services [CMS], 2020). It should be noted that Part A only covers medications that a patient gets while the patient is hospitalized. Part A does not cover the whole length of stay at a skilled nursing facility. Part B covers services that are provided by a doctor (CMS, 2020). The problem with this part of the program, is that people have to pay a premium. Part D covers prescription drugs. There is a coverage gap in Part D which kicks in when a person reaches $4,020 in total drug costs (Austin & Wetle, 2017). I argue that the Social Security program needs to be drastically changed. This program has to be improved as there are many issues associated with it. There is a possibility that the money in this program can run out. Benefits have to be improved for those who need it the most, while those who do not need benefits more than others should have their benefits reduced. There also has to be more done to address the issue of fraud. Reply 2 The major components of Medicare include inpatient/hospital coverage, outpatient coverage, and alternate ways of receiving Medicare. The three components of Medicaid are family care, nursing home care, and personal care. The gap in Medicaid is that its reach has not benefitted some citizens in the states which have not fully embraced its expansion owing to the June 2012 Supreme Court ruling, which indicated that the coverage was optional (Segal et al., 2014). This has let the promise of widening coverage to lower-income families and individuals under the Affordable Care Act not met, leaving many people with no health security. The other gap is that even for patients who are covered, the program does not fully meet the patient costs, and they have to rely on some health insurance. If you can’t afford a policy, you are still not covered adequately. The gaps in Medicare is the limited extent it has on prescription costs, requiring that patients meet some part of the drug costs. So for people with limited income or no income at all, they are exposed. The second one is that it has limited coverage for traveling risks of health. In my view, social Security program is hugely relevant to the American public, need to be expanded as well as beefed up to serve as many as possible. This is because the programs help accord people easy post-retirement life as it gives them income, medical care (Segal et al., 2014). It also gives them a choice when they want to receive benefits and allows eligible non-working spouses to receive benefits. The program should be modified to expand its reach and its services enhanced to make life secure post-retirement.
